今天给各位分享discuz数据库端口号的知识,其中也会对discuz论坛服务器要求进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
- 1、DISCUZ论坛服务器都需要哪些端口?我们这边服务器要上防火墙!
- 2、搭建Discuz论坛安装时出错,提示“由于目标计算机积极拒绝,无法连接。”肿么办啊~~哭
- 3、基于apache搭建discuz可以修改端口号吗
- 4、Discuz导入mysql出现#1062怎么解决?
- 5、Discuz 远程连接数据库
1、DISCUZ论坛服务器都需要哪些端口?我们这边服务器要上防火墙!
对外的80端口就行,另外不清楚你防火墙的拦截方式,有可能需要mysql的端口也放行,还有就是如果装memcache,memecache的端口也可能需要放行一下
2、搭建Discuz论坛安装时出错,提示“由于目标计算机积极拒绝,无法连接。”肿么办啊~~哭
我今天遇到一模一样的问题了,你首先确保通过命令提示符能连上MySql数据库,然后在这里返回上一步,在数据库地址那加上端口号。我机子上的MySql数据库的端口号是3333,所以写上localhost:3333,然后再下一步,应该就行了。。
以上只是我遇到问题的解决方法,不清楚具体你那是什么原因导致这个错误的,所以我提供的方法不一定能解决你的问题。
反正可以肯定这个和Windows7 操作系统没有关系,因为我的就是Win7
3、基于apache搭建discuz可以修改端口号吗
本帖最后由 s_gugs 于 2009-3-4 19:07 编辑
更改apache端口的方法
今天在安装php运行环境时发现apache运行不起来,第一想到的就是80端口被占用了, 随便在这里提一下自己对于80端口被占用的具体情况。
IIS默认起用的是80端口, 迅雷和SKYPE也会占用80端口。
如果不知道80端口被那个软件占用,如果您安装了360安全卫士,你可以用360安全卫士查找80端口被谁占用。
今天我的情况很明显是开启了IIS,我用的是2003 server。 由于apache默认的端口和IIS的一样,所以就需要更改了
下面就进入更改apache端口修改
进入apache安装目录,找到conf配置文件夹,点击进入后找到httpd.conf. 你选择用记事本的方式打开后ctrl+f查找
listen直到找到 listen 80 ,然后把80改成你想要更改的端口,注意千万不要改你电脑上已用过的端口就OK了,更改后保存。
之后你浏览apache服务器中的网页就要在你的IP下加入(比如你把80改成了81).
就这样更改就OK了,希望能给有此疑惑的朋友些帮助
忘了一点:更改后请重新启动apache
4、Discuz导入mysql出现#1062怎么解决?
当mysql出现”ERROR 1062”错误时:查看字段的属性是否合理,不合理,则修改该字段的属性;合理,则进行表的恢复。如下图也有可能是:ERROR 1062: Duplicate entry ‘13747’ for key 1 等(所有这种1062类型的错误)。
本地数据库:mysql -u用户名 -p密码 (本地) 远程数据库:mysql -h地址(ip如192.16.1.1) -u用户名 -p密码 -P端口号
首先查看数据库中该字段类型是否合理,比如字段的类型和定义的长度等是否与实际存入的值不相符,用 show create table 表名; 查看表的结构,下图是接着上图错误进入数据库中查看字段属性。
检查”come_from” 字段类型与大小是否合理,若不合理则用以下命令修改该字段的属性:
alter table 表名称 change 字段名称 字段名称 字段类型 [是否允许非空],alter table 表名称 modify 字段名称 字段类型 [是否允许非空]。
最后,如果检查发现字段定义不存在问题,那我们可以用:repair table 表名; 语句进行表恢复,表越大,需要的时间越长,慢慢等就是了。
5、Discuz 远程连接数据库
?php
$conn = mysql_connect('IP地址:端口号(3306)','用户名','密码') or die('数据库连接不成功!');
mysql_select_db('库',$conn);
?
好像这样。。
关于discuz数据库端口号和discuz论坛服务器要求的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。